The Chinese Beijing Opera, also known as Peking Opera, is a traditional form of Chinese theater that has been around for over 200 years.
It combines music, singing, dancing, and acrobatics to tell stories from Chinese history and mythology.
The opera's performers are called "divas" or "dang", and they wear elaborate costumes and headpieces that reflect their personalities and roles.

In addition to costumes, Peking Opera also features headpieces that are worn by the performers.
These headpieces can be made of various materials such as silk, gold, and silver, and they often have intricate designs and patterns.
They are used to enhance the performer's appearance and add to the overall visual impact of the performance.
